- A collection of winter night photos I took between November and December 2022. All photos were captured in RAW with Fuji X-T20 + XF 35mm f1.4 paired with Tiffen black pro-mist 1/4 filter and edited in Capture One.

Hi man! Beautiful shots! Can I ask what iso you recommend for shooting in this conditions?
Thank you so much Giorgio, much appreciated! I always check exposure on histogram and I usually try to not go over 3200 but higher noise is still better then missed shot so I'll increase it if it's necessay. Hope that helps! :)

Hello, have you ever shot on an xt30 before? And now on the xt20? Why is that?
Hi - yes, you're right - I originally bought X-T30 II but quickly returned it back and I intentionally downgraded to older X-T20 because I realized I don't really need a brand new and more expensive camera body and X-T20 has the same sensor as X100F which I've already had so I knew it would work for me.
